accountability
Meaning
- (uncountable, usually) The state of being accountable; liability to be called on to render an account or give an explanation; liability to be held responsible or answerable for something.
- (uncountable, usually) An open determination of one's responsibility for something and imposition of consequences.
- (uncountable, usually) An acceptance of good faith of one's responsibility for something and of its consequences.
- (uncountable, usually) The obligation imposed by law or regulation on an officer or other person for keeping an accurate record of property, documents, or funds.
